Market Overview

The global cold form blister packaging market refers to packaging solutions made using aluminum based laminates that are shaped without heat to create high barrier cavities that handle moisture oxygen and light protection needs of pharmaceutical and electronic products Market growth is driven by increasing demand for safe pharmaceutical packaging which results from the rising prevalence of chronic diseases and expanding healthcare expenditure in emerging economies The FDA and WHO establish strict regulations that government initiatives use to promote tamper evident packaging and contamination resistant packaging solutions In January 2025 Indias Ministry of Environment Forest and Climate Change MoEFCC updated the Plastic Waste Management Rules GSR 73E introducing requirements for QR codes barcodes or unique identification numbers on plastic packaging to improve traceability and accountability in waste management These regulations apply broadly to multilayered and other plastic packaging including cold form blister packs aligning with global efforts to enhance sustainable packaging practices Key market trends include growing preference for sustainable materials and unit dose packaging and the rise of online pharmacies In April 2025 Amcor plc completed its all stock combination with Berry Global strengthening its global packaging portfolio including healthcare and pharmaceutical segments relevant to cold form blister packaging The merger is expected to generate approximately USD 650 million in total synergies by fiscal 2028 with USD 260 million in pre tax synergies projected in FY2026 alone Post merger the combined company anticipates annual cash flow exceeding USD 3 billion by FY2028 providing significant investment capacity for manufacturing expansion RD and innovation in high barrier and protective packaging solutions The development of enhanced laminate structures improved sealing methods and child resistant designs has created advancements that boost product performance The expanding healthcare infrastructure in developing regions creates opportunities because of rising disposable incomes and increasing need for durable high protection packaging solutions

Driving Factors 

The global cold form blister packaging market expands because demand for high-barrier pharmaceutical packages that maintain product security and extended shelf life grows. The rising number of chronic illnesses and the increasing use of pharmaceutical products have created a greater need for medical packaging solutions. The market growth receives additional support from strict regulations, which mandate packaging designs to include both tamper-evidence and contamination protection features. The healthcare sector in emerging markets experiences rapid expansion, which leads to greater demand for medical products because pharmaceutical companies increase their investments. The growth of e-commerce and online pharmacy channels creates forces that drive the adoption of unit-dose packaging and secure transport solutions.

 

Restraining Factors

The global cold form blister packaging market is restrained by its production costs and material expenses exceeding those of thermoformed packaging solutions, which makes it unsuitable for budget-friendly uses. The adoption of the technology faces two major hurdles because of its restricted design options and its production speed, which falls below requirements for high-volume packaging operations. Environmental concerns about aluminum-based laminates, together with recycling difficulties of multi-layer materials, block market expansion because of rising sustainability regulations.

Recent Development

  • In January 2026 ACG Packaging Materials launched SuperPod a breakthrough cold form blister technology that reduces blister cavity size by up to 39 This innovation enhances sustainability by lowering material usage and transportation costs while maintaining full barrier protection and compatibility with the existing packaging line
     
  • In October 2024 Bayer and Liveo Research introduced a recyclable one material blister pack made from polyethylene terephthalate PET as an alternative to traditional PVC blister packaging The new PET blister reduces carbon footprint and resource use while improving recyclability and was launched with Bayers Aleve product range in the Netherlands
     
  • In July 2023 Constantia Flexibles introduced REGULA CIRC a next generation cold form aluminum foil designed for enhanced sustainability and circularity in pharmaceutical blister packaging REGULA CIRC reduces plastic content by replacing traditional PVC with a polyethylene sealing layer and increases aluminum content which improves recyclability and material recovery while maintaining total barrier protection against moisture oxygen light and gases

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

  • 1. What is cold form blister packaging?
    A: Cold form blister packaging uses aluminum‑based laminates shaped without heat to create sealed cavities that protect products like tablets and capsules from moisture, oxygen, and light.
  • 2. Why is cold-form blister packaging preferred in the pharmaceutical industry?
    A: It offers high barrier protection, tamper evidence, and extended shelf life, making it ideal for sensitive drugs and strict regulatory environments.
  • 3. How does cold-form blister packaging differ from thermoform packaging?
    A: Cold form uses multilayer foil and pressure to form cavities, offering better barrier properties, while thermoform uses heat on plastics with generally lower protection.
  • 4. What are the sustainability challenges with cold-form blister packs?
    A: Recycling is difficult because of multi‑layer materials, and aluminum production has environmental impacts, prompting interest in more recyclable alternatives.
  • 5. What role does automation play in this market?
    A: Automation improves production consistency, reduces costs, and enhances speed and quality control in blister forming, sealing, and inspection processes.
  • 6. How do regulations impact market growth?
    A: Strict pharmaceutical and packaging regulations on safety, tamper evidence, and product traceability increase demand for compliant blister packaging solutions.
  • 7. What technological trends are shaping the market?
    A: Innovations include reduced material usage, enhanced sealing methods, smart packaging features like QR code traceability, and more recyclable material development.
